out of 5 stars Columbus, GA Major Duties and Responsibilities This position is responsible for assisting in directing the overall activities of the Waste Disposal Division. Assists in the direction and scheduling of operations at the landfill and ensures work is completed as scheduled in accordance with prescribed methods and procedures. Interviews, hires, trains, assigns, schedules, supervises, evaluates, and disciplines personnel. Inspects work for compliance with rules, regulations, and safety guidelines; conducts equipment and inventory inspections; checks vehicles for maintenance and repair needs. Approves purchases of supplies and replacement equipment; identifies and purchases new equipment. Approves and reviews environmental monitoring reports and maintains all division inventory of equipment. Assists in developing and monitoring budgets including equipment specifications, annual contracts, and the long-term goals of the division. Enforces environmental regulations to maintain compliance with state regulations. Submits payroll for all Solid Waste Division hourly and salary employees. Approves daily and monthly tonnage and revenue reports. Oversees small and large projects associated with the operation of a solid waste landfill Inspects incoming loads for prohibited waste and approves incoming special handling loads for disposal. Works to encourage waste reduction through recycling and diversion. Updates Public Works website and Integrated Waste section of website, updates Columbus GA Recycles app, runs CCG Integrated Waste Facebook page. Attends training seminars and conferences. Performs other related duties as assigned. Knowledge, Skills and Abilities Knowledge in waste diversion and waste reduction practices. Knowledge of the principles, practices, and techniques utilized in the performance of waste disposal activities. Knowledge of federal and state regulations concerning the operation of a landfill. Knowledge of the principles and practices of report preparation, filing, and records management. Knowledge of the principles and practices of public administration. Skill in developing and implementing policies and procedures. Skill in problem solving and decision making. Skill in management and supervision. Skill in operating standard office equipment including work related computer applications. Skill in oral and written communication. Skill in budgetary development and management. Ability to work independently with minimal supervision. Ability to operate a motor vehicle. Minimum Educational and Training Requirements Bachelor’s degree in Environmental Science, Geology, or any field related to Environmental Studies is required. Experience sufficient to thoroughly understand the work of subordinate positions and to be able to answer questions and resolve problems, usually associated with three to five years experience or service. Possession of or ability to readily obtain a valid driver’s license issued by the State of Georgia for the type of vehicle or equipment operated. Possession of or an ability to readily obtain State of Georgia certification as a “Certified Landfill Operator” within 12 months of employment.
